## Why Your Invitation Workflow Is the Backbone of Your Event

Most planners focus their energy on the venue, the catering, and the decor. The invitation process often gets treated as an afterthought. That is a mistake.

Think about it this way: your invitation is doing several jobs at once. It is informing guests, collecting responses, managing dietary preferences or access needs, and building anticipation. When that system breaks down, everything downstream breaks too.

### The Real Cost of Outdated Invitation Methods

Consider Sarah, a corporate event planner in Chicago who managed a 300-person product launch using email blasts and a shared Google Sheet for RSVPs. By the week of the event, she had duplicate entries, guests who never confirmed, and a catering headcount that was off by nearly 40 people. The event still went well, but she spent 12 extra hours in the week prior just cleaning up data.

That kind of friction is entirely avoidable with the right event invitation software.

### 2. Guest List Management That Actually Scales

Managing 50 guests is manageable in a notebook. Managing 500 is a different experience entirely. Good guest list tools give you the ability to segment your list (VIPs, vendors, media, general attendees), filter by RSVP status, and communicate with specific groups without blasting everyone.

Look for platforms that support bulk imports from CSV files and integrate with your existing contacts. The less manual data entry you are doing, the fewer errors you are introducing.

### 3. Automated Communication Sequences

One of the most underused features in modern event planner tools is automated messaging. Once a guest RSVPs, they should immediately receive a confirmation. A week before the event, they should get a reminder. The day before, a final nudge with directions or a link to join virtually.

Setting these sequences up once saves hours of manual follow-up. It also makes your event feel more professional and thoughtful to attendees, which reflects well on you as a planner.

### 4. Real-Time Analytics and Reporting

Knowing where you stand at any moment is critical. How many people have opened the invitation? What percentage have responded? Which segment of your list is not engaging?

Real-time data lets you make smarter decisions. If RSVPs are slow in the first week, you can send a targeted nudge before the deadline rather than panicking the day before the event. Good event invitation software surfaces this information clearly, without requiring you to dig through raw data.

### 5. Mobile-Optimized Design Tools

In 2026, the vast majority of guests are opening invitations on their phones. If your invitation looks awkward on a mobile screen or takes too long to load, your open and response rates will suffer.

## What to Look for When Choosing an Invitation Platform for Events

Not all platforms are created equal. Here are the questions worth asking before you commit:

- Does it support custom branding so your invitations do not look generic?

- Can guests RSVP without creating an account or downloading an app?

- Is the RSVP data exportable in a format your other tools can use?

- Does the platform offer customer support when things go sideways?

- Is pricing transparent and scalable as your event sizes grow?

These questions separate the tools that look good in a demo from the ones that actually hold up when you are managing a live event with real guests.
